Overview: What Are Screenless AI Wearables?
Screenless AI wearables are devices that remove the traditional display and replace it with:
- Voice interaction
- Context-aware AI
- Audio or haptic feedback
- Cloud or hybrid on-device intelligence

Real-World Performance and Daily Use
In everyday scenarios, screenless AI wearables excel at:
- Recording meetings and summarizing conversations
- Answering contextual questions hands-free
- Managing reminders and voice notes
- Acting as an AI “second brain”
However, they are not replacements for smartphones. Instead, they complement phones by handling quick interactions without pulling you into endless notifications.
Battery life varies widely, but most last a full working day with moderate use.

Comparison: Screenless AI vs Smartwatches
Unlike smartwatches:
- No notifications overload
- No constant visual engagement
- Focus on cognition, not fitness
Compared to earbuds or assistants:
- More context-aware
- Designed for continuous daily use
Screenless AI wearables occupy a new category, not a replacement for existing ones.
FAQ — Frequently Asked Questions
Do screenless AI wearables replace smartphones?
No. They complement smartphones by handling quick, hands-free interactions.
Are these devices always listening?
Most activate only via wake words or physical gestures, but privacy policies vary by brand.
Are they worth it in 2026?
For productivity-focused users, yes. For casual users, results may vary.
Do they work offline?
Limited functionality offline; most rely on cloud AI.
Who benefits the most from this tech?
Professionals, students, writers, and anyone aiming to reduce screen time.
